Angular 中的 LocalStorage 指令的使用

阅读时长 3 分钟读完

在前端开发中,我们经常需要将一些数据保存在本地,以便下次访问时能够快速加载。而 LocalStorage 是一种在浏览器端存储数据的机制,可以将数据保存在用户的本地浏览器中。在 Angular 中,我们可以使用 LocalStorage 指令来方便地使用 LocalStorage。

LocalStorage 指令的介绍

LocalStorage 指令是 Angular 提供的一个指令,用于在组件中访问 LocalStorage。它可以帮助我们在组件中轻松地读写 LocalStorage 中的数据,并且提供了一些常用的 API,如 set、get、remove 等。

LocalStorage 指令的使用

要在 Angular 中使用 LocalStorage 指令,首先需要在组件中引入该指令:

然后,我们可以在组件中使用 LocalStorage 指令来读写 LocalStorage 中的数据。例如,我们可以在组件中定义一个变量来保存 LocalStorage 中的数据:

-- -------------------- ---- -------
------ - --------- - ---- ----------------
------ - ------------ - ---- -------------------------

------------
  --------- -----------
  ------------ -----------------------
  ---------- -----------------------
--
------ ----- ------------ -
  ----- ----

  ------------------- ------------- ------------- --

  ---------- -
    ------------------------------------------------ -- -
      --------- - -----
    ---
  -

  ---------- -
    ------------------------------- ----------------------- -- ----
  -
-

在上面的代码中,我们使用了 LocalStorage 指令中的 get 和 set API 来读写 LocalStorage 中的数据。在 ngOnInit 方法中,我们使用 get API 来获取 LocalStorage 中的数据,并将其保存在组件的 data 变量中。在 saveData 方法中,我们使用 set API 将组件中的数据保存到 LocalStorage 中。

LocalStorage 指令的优势

使用 LocalStorage 指令可以带来以下优势:

  1. 简化代码:LocalStorage 指令提供了一些常用的 API,可以帮助我们更轻松地读写 LocalStorage 中的数据,从而简化了代码。

  2. 提高可读性:使用 LocalStorage 指令可以使代码更易于理解和维护,因为它提供了一种统一的方式来访问 LocalStorage 中的数据。

  3. 改善性能:LocalStorage 指令可以帮助我们缓存数据,从而提高应用程序的性能和响应速度。

总结

LocalStorage 指令是 Angular 中一个非常有用的指令,可以帮助我们更轻松地读写 LocalStorage 中的数据。在本文中,我们介绍了 LocalStorage 指令的基本用法,并讨论了它的优势。通过使用 LocalStorage 指令,我们可以简化代码、提高可读性和改善性能。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/65790970d2f5e1655d2f7a4e

纠错
反馈